Just saw a bulletin from Honda that some A01 filters may have a manufacturing defect where the threads are crooked. This can cause the metal housing of the filter to hit the engine block before the seal which can create an oil leak.
The affected filters have lot numbers of 7A26, 7A29, 7A30, 7A31, 7B01, 7B02, 7B03.
This only applies to the A01 filters and only those with the above lot#'s.
We haven't had the A01 filters for about 5-6 months now and the A02's don't have any that are bad.
I'm not sure when the affected lot numbers came out but Honda has gone through quite a few of the A01's since we got our last batch of them.
